The Rise of E-Cigarettes
E-cigarettes entered the market as a less harmful alternative to conventional smoking, with many users under the impression that they are a safer choice. These devices deliver nicotine through a vapor, rather than smoke, by heating a liquid that usually contains nicotine, flavorings, and other chemicals.
Understanding the Cancer Risk
While electronic cigarettes are marketed as safer alternatives, recent studies have raised concerns about their potential links to cancer. The primary concern lies in the chemicals contained within the e-liquid and the resultant vapor. Research has indicated that while e-cigarettes expose users to fewer toxicants than traditional cigarettes, they still contain substances that may increase cancer risk.
Key Chemicals in E-Cigarettes
One of the critical components is nicotine, which, although not directly a carcinogen, promotes tumor development. Flavoring agents used in e-liquids can transform into toxic compounds during the vaping process. Additionally, the presence of heavy metals from the heating elements poses its own set of risks.
Scientific Studies and Findings
Recent studies have shown that e-cigarette vapor can cause oxidative stress and inflammation in body tissues, processes which are known to contribute to cancer. A significant concern is also the production of formaldehyde, a recognized carcinogen, under certain conditions during vaping.
Comparison with Traditional Cigarettes
While the carcinogenic content in e-cigarettes is notably lower than in traditional cigarettes, there is still a lack of conclusive long-term studies. This uncertainty suggests that while e-cigarettes might pose a reduced risk, they are not entirely free from cancer-causing agents.
